Lesson: KWL
Comprehension
Outcomes:
Make connections between the ways different authors may represent similar storylines,
ideas and relationships(ACELT1602)
Readdifferenttypes of textsby combining contextual , semantic, grammatical
andphonicknowledge usingtext processing strategiesfor example monitoring meaning,
cross checking and reviewing(ACELY1691)
Usecomprehension strategiesto build literal and inferred meaning to expand content
knowledge, integrating and linking ideas and analysing and evaluating
texts(ACELY1692)
Introduction:
- Begin with explanation of the KWL chart
- As a group, look at the front cover of the
text and flip through the book.
- Fill in the 'K' and 'W' parts of the chart
Body:
- Read, 'Green Eggs and Ham'
- Discuss as a group, what each member
wanted to learn and what they already
knew .
- How did their prior knowldge effect their
opinion of the book?
Materials:
- KWL Chart
- 'Green Eggs and Ham' (Dr. Suess)
Conclusion:
- Indidvidually or as a group, fill out the 'L'
part of the KWL chart
- Discuss the results as a group.
